  • My brand new out the box airport extreme won't let anything connect to it.

    My brand new out the box 5th gen (2013) airport extreme won't let anything connect to it. I've tried several setups from sratch by the book. multiple resets and restores still nothing. It just keeps telling mt that the password is in correct even though it is 100% right.
    My curren set up is as follows. Phone Line -> ADSL2+ router -> Airport extreme. There is also an old airport express running of the router, this was done because the airport extremem was failing to work.
    Trying to connect:
    2x iPhone 4s
    2x macbook air
    2x Mac Pro.

    You will want the Extreme to be in bridge mode if it is currently disabled. (see image below)
    This will allow the ADSL2+ router to perform two important functions for your entire network: 1) Provide both the DHCP & NAT services, and 2) Provide PPPoE support to allow access to your ADSL ISPs network.
    If the Extreme is left in its default state, a router, it will conflict with the first item and you will have want is known as a "double NAT" condition. Something you will want to avoid.

  • Unable to check for available downloads. The network connection timed out.

    I downloaded iTunes 10.1.2 last week, and attempted to upgrade some music to iTunes Plus. I'm showing 35 items in my download queue, but when I attempt to download I get a message "Unable to check for available downloads. Network connection timed out."
    I e-mailed Apple Tech Support multiple times, and received their standard list of links for things to try. So far I have reinstalled iTunes, turned off my Norton Firewall, checked the program rules settings, flushed the dns cache, and unchecked the "allow simultaneous downloads" box. Still no luck.
    Apple's last e-mail requested I send them my account info so they could reset my password, and check my system. I'm still waiting for that to happen.
    I'd appreciate any user suggestions for this problem.

    Fundamentally it is an apple itunes server issue - if you have a lot of downloads the "check for downloads" request can take longer than the default windows internet connection timeout setting - which is 30 seconds on more recent versions of windows.
    You can work around it though - without requiring apple to "segment" your download list, by adding a windows registry setting.
    Apple re-enabled my downloads after I was burgled and then I was stuck - my "check for downloads" was always timing out - and the support guy had no clue - so I went digging, and found a a microsoft article here http://support.microsoft.com/kb/181050 which tells you how to change change that default timout value by adding a registry setting. Besides adding the ReceiveTimeout setting detailed on that page - I also changed the KeepAliveTimeout - just in case.
    HKEYCURRENTUSER\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Internet Settings\ReceiveTimeout
    which I set to 180000 milliseconds (3 mins)
    HKEYCURRENTUSER\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Internet Settings\KeepAliveTimeout
    which I set to 181000 milliseconds (3 mins and 1 second)
    Use regedit to make the change - both settings are DWORDS with decimal values. You'll need to restart your PC to apply the change.
    After the change and restart and one initial failed attempt the request for downloads worked - when the apple itunes server responded after 2 minutes !!

  • How to add an out-of-box JMS modules?

    Hi,
    I am using WebLogic Server 10.3. For my project, I need to add some out-of-box JMS modules so that there is no need to ask the administrators to create and configure them. I wonder how I can achieve this. Is it good enough just to make changes on the config/config.xml and add a corresponding *-jms.xml?
    Thank you,
    Yang

    Here's a more sophisticated version of the script Kats supplied. It is a bit more flexible, and works around issues that can arise if too many changes are attempted within the same edit session.
    # Sample WLST code for creating a simple WebLogic JMS
    # configuration using WLST.
    # This script sets up two JMS servers on the same
    # WebLogic server, each with a queue and a topic.
    import sys
    from java.lang import System
    # A method for finding an mbean.
    # It uses "cd()" rather than getMBean() as "cd()" works in more cases.
    def findMBean(path):
        savePWD=pwd()
        try:
            cd(path)
            value=cmo
            cd(savePWD)
            return value
        except:
            print ' --- Please ignore the previous *No stack trace available.* message.'
            cd(savePWD)
            return None
    # A method for creating a JMS server.
    def findOrCreateJMSServer(serverMBean, jmsServerName):
        jmsServerMBean = findMBean('JMSServers/'+jmsServerName)
        if jmsServerMBean is not None:
            print ' --- JMS Server '+jmsServerName+' already exists.'
            return jmsServerMBean
        startEdit()
        jmsServerMBean = create(jmsServerName,'JMSServer')
        jmsServerMBean.addTarget(serverMBean)
        save()
        activate(block="true")
        print ' --- JMS Server '+jmsServerName+' created.'
        return jmsServerMBean
    # A method for creating a JMS module for hosting JMS config,
    # also creates a subdeployment named 'TheOne' for the JMS server.
    # The module target is set to be the same target that's used
    # for the passed in JMS server.
    def findOrCreateJMSModule(jmsServerMBean, moduleName):
        jmsResource = findMBean('JMSSystemResources/'+moduleName)
        if jmsResource is not None:
            print ' --- Module '+moduleName+' already exists.'
            return jmsResource
        startEdit()
        jmsResource = create(moduleName,'JMSSystemResource')
        jmsResource.addTarget(jmsServerMBean.getTarget())
        subD = jmsResource.createSubDeployment('TheOne')
        subD.addTarget(jmsServerMBean)
        save()
        activate(block="true")
        print ' --- Module '+moduleName+' created.'
        return jmsResource
    # A method for creating a JMS destination.   Pass 'Queue' or 'Topic'
    # for destType.  This method assumes subdeployment named 'TheOne'.
    def findOrCreateJMSDest(destType, jmsModule, destName, destJNDIName):
        # see if dest already exists
        moduleName=jmsModule.getName()
        longname='JMSSystemResources/'+moduleName+'/JMSResource/'+moduleName
        if (destType == 'Queue'):
          longname+='/Queues/'+destName
        elif (destType == 'Topic'):
          longname+='/Topics/'+destName
        else:
          raise Exception('Unknown dest type '+destType)
        jmsDest = findMBean(longname)
        if jmsDest is not None:
          print ' --- Destination '+destName+' already exists.'
          return jmsDest
        # dest does not exist, create it
        startEdit()
        if (destType == 'Queue'):
          jmsDest = jmsModule.getJMSResource().createQueue(destName)
        else:
          jmsDest = jmsModule.getJMSResource().createTopic(destName)
        jmsDest.setJNDIName(destJNDIName)
        jmsDest.setSubDeploymentName('TheOne')
        save()
        activate(block="true")
        print ' --- Destination '+destName+' created.'
        return jmsDest
    # Connect to a WebLogic Admin Server. When username, password
    # and URL are not passed as arguments, connect will prompt
    # for these values.
    #connect('system','mypassword','t3://mymachine:7001')
    connect()
    edit() # Navigate to the root of the config MBean tree.
    print ' --- Enter the name of the WLS server that will host the JMS servers.'
    print ' --- Choices: ---'
    ls('Servers')
    print ' ----------------'
    print ' --- --> ',
    wlServerName=sys.stdin.readline().strip()
    svMBean=findMBean("Servers/"+wlServerName)
    if svMBean is None:
        print ' --- WebLogic server '+wlServerName+' not found.'
        stopExecution(' --- Cannot find the WebLogic myserver '+wlServerName)
    try:
          jmsServerMBean = findOrCreateJMSServer(svMBean, 'MyJMSServer')
          jmsModule = findOrCreateJMSModule(jmsServerMBean, 'MyJMSModule')
          findOrCreateJMSDest('Queue', jmsModule, 'MyQueue', 'MyQueue')
          findOrCreateJMSDest('Topic', jmsModule, 'MyTopic', 'MyTopic')
        print ' --- Configuration complete.'
    except:
        dumpStack()
        print ' --- Error, admin server log may contain details!!!'
        stopEdit('y')
